Step-by-step explanation:
1. Let's review the information given to answer the question correctly:
Number of patients Dr. Irvine see in a week = 130
Radio of kids to adults = 3:7 or 3/7
Number of Kids = k
Number of adults = d
2. Let's find the equations system that should be set up to find out how many kids Dr. Irvine see
k + d = 130 (Number of patients Dr. Irvine see in a week)
Including the ratio:
7k = 3d
Replacing d:
d = 130 - k
Now substituting:
7k = 3 * (130 - k)
7k = 390 - 3k
10k = 390
k = 390/10
<u>k = 39</u>

You need 864.52 sq. in. of blue tile.
We need to find the area of the large circle (including blue and yellow) and the area of the yellow circle.
We have the circumference of the blue circle, 113.097.
C = πd
113.097 = 3.14d
Divide both sides by 3.14:
113.097/3.14 = 3.14d/3.14
36.018 = d
The diameter is twice as much as the radius, so r = 36.018/2 = 18.009.
The area of a circle is given by the formula
A = πr²
A = 3.14(18.009)² = 1018.38 sq. in.
The area of the small yellow circle is given by
A = 3.14(7²) = 3.14(49) = 153.86
Subtracting these two, we have
1018.38 - 153.86 = 864.52 sq. in.
